Transaction ecdaa977c11a0b2b24f9824200dd74af74cba8d56df36d544292e21d1e6d4224
1 Input
1 Output
-
ecdaa977c11a0b2b24f9824200dd74af74cba8d56df36d544292e21d1e6d4224:0
- value
- 992027630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f0d1d3a41a2b8d2f366dccaaa79eb6e50d7522 OP_EQUAL
- address
- MSQDDd1Ais1Gk7EZgv8FeC7iSFNudLre7y